What are the main differences between patty and fenugreek?

  • Patty is richer in vitamin B12, while fenugreek is higher in iron, copper, fiber, manganese, magnesium, vitamin B6, vitamin B1, and phosphorus.
  • Fenugreek's daily need coverage for iron is 395% higher.
  • Fenugreek is lower in saturated fat.

We used USDA Commodity, beef, patties (100%), frozen, raw and Spices, fenugreek seed types in this comparison.
